Display and Design: Big Screen Experience
Huge 2.01-Inch Display
The main feature of the Fire-Boltt Hunter 51.1mm is its massive display. The 2.01-inch TFT screen has 240 × 296 pixel resolution. With 450 nits brightness, you can see the screen clearly even when you’re outside in sunlight.
The rectangular shape makes it easy to read messages and see health data. While it’s not the sharpest display available, it’s good enough for a budget watch. The colors look decent and the screen responds well to touch.
Metal Look Design
Even though this is a budget watch, Fire-Boltt has made it look premium. The watch case is made from ABS+PC and zinc alloy with special coating that makes it look like real metal. This gives the watch an expensive appearance even though it costs less than ₹1500.
The watch weighs only 36.8 grams, so it feels light on your wrist. The silicone strap is 24mm wide and you can replace it with other straps if you want. The watch has IP67 water resistance, which means it can handle water splashes and rain.

Battery Life: How Long Does It Last?
Different Usage, Different Battery Life
The battery life of the Fire-Boltt Hunter 51.1mm depends on how you use it:
- Without Bluetooth calling: 5-7 days of normal use
- With Bluetooth calling active: Only 1-2 days
- Standby mode: Up to 15 days when not actively used
The watch takes about 3 hours to charge fully using the magnetic charging cable. Most people need to charge it every 2-3 days if they use calling features regularly.

Technical Specifications Summary
Feature | Details |
---|---|
Display | 2.01-inch TFT, 240×296 pixels, 450 nits brightness |
Processor | Single Chip Technology |
Battery | 280mAh, 1-7 days depending on usage |
Connectivity | Bluetooth 5.0, Built-in GPS |
Health Sensors | Heart rate, SpO2, sleep tracker, step counter |
Water Resistance | IP67 rated |
Weight | 36.8 grams |
Compatibility | Android 5.0+, iOS 9.0+ |
Sports Modes | 120+ different activities |
Watch Faces | 8 built-in + 130+ downloadable |
